Sheffield United has secured the signing of Nigerian winger Christian Nwachukwu from Bulgarian club Botev Plovdiv for an undisclosed fee.
The 19-year-old has signed a contract with the Blades until 2027, with an option to extend for two additional years.
Nwachukwu, who played a pivotal role in Botev Plovdiv’s Bulgarian Cup triumph and gained Europa League experience this season, expressed excitement about the move.
“I’m looking forward to coming to Sheffield to play for United and continue my development. I look forward to meeting the lads and getting started,” he told the club’s official website.
The transfer remains subject to the completion and approval of relevant documentation.
